Statute of Limitations

The statute of limitations can be complicated due to the fact that asbestos-related illnesses such as mesothelioma may take years to be diagnosed. An experienced lawyer can help patients determine their deadlines and file within the timeframes. The lawyer will go over the claim, inform the defendants, construct the case using evidence, and either negotiate a settlement or plead for a jury verdict at trial.

State-specific statutes of limitations for personal injury and wrongful death cases are different. Many factors play into the way in which the statute of limitations will be used, including when asbestos exposure occurred, the location where the victim lives, which states they worked in, and the location of asbestos-related businesses.

The majority of asbestos victims benefit from the discovery rule which allows a statute of limitations clock to begin at the point the disease was first discovered or the time it should be reasonably discovered. This differs from the statutory periods of states that are usually set to begin with the date of the first exposure.

In certain situations, the statute of limitations may be extended or paused. For instance, if the victim is minor or does not have the legal capacity to submit an action. In some cases, such as fraud concealment the statute of limitations may be extended.

If the statute of limitations expires before a mesothelioma suit is filed, the victims may lose the chance to receive compensation. They might have other options to receive financial compensation, including trust funds and insurance.

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os victims suffering from m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ases can seek compensation through trust funds. These trust funds were created by companies that manufactured or supplied asbestos-containing products and went through bankruptcy. To avoid being sued the companies were compelled by bankruptcy courts to set aside funds in trusts so that victims could receive financial compensation.

To receive financial compensation, victims must meet the eligibility requirements of each asbestos trust.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ims to understand these criteria and gather documents needed to make an application. This includes evidence of employment, military service documents and complete medical records that prove the victim was diagnosed with an asbestos-related condition.

Mesothelioma lawyers also assist victims with filing for faster reviews at each asbestos trust fund. This allows claims to be processed quicker and may increase the amount of compensation a person is awarded. There is a limit to the amount of compensation a person is able to receive through an expedited review.

The asbestos trust fund can offer compensation of up to six figures for victims of asbestos-related ailments. This compensation is intended to cover a wide range of expenses, such as funeral costs, mesothelioma treatment as well as lost income and future losses.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can file legal claims to recover compensation. Compensation can be in the form of a cash settlement, or an award from a jury. The value of a claim is contingent on the nature and severity of the asbestos-related disease, the degree to the extent that the victim's quality of life has been diminished and the amount of lost wages and medical expenses. A mesothelioma attorney will examine your case and inform you the options available to compensation.

Most mesothelioma cases settle outside of court. The defendants do not wish to incur the cost of trial, therefore they settle their cases relatively early in the legal process.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ma cases can to pinpoint possible sources of compensation quickly. They will often review long-lost purchase orders or witness statements and then examine other documents to determine the asbestos exposure at a particular area.

The companies that mined and produced asbestos, and those who produced and used asbestos-containing items, should pay awards to victims of mesothelioma. The victims are typically exposed workers who were deprived of their rights by defendants who placed them in the presence of this carcinogen.

In most states, a person diagnosed with mesothelioma is entitled to sue the company who caused the injury. These lawsuits are known as personal injury or mesothelioma suits.

Workers' compensation claims may be filed by people or loved ones of those who have been diagnosed with asbestos-related diseases. These claims can be used to be used to cover medical expenses as well as income loss. These claims are typically filed with the state workers' compensation office. It is also important to consider whether they are eligible for government-run insurance programs like Medicare and Medicaid which provide healthcare coverage for seniors and those with a low income.

Veterans who have been exposed to asbestos while serving in military can apply for VA benefits. VA benefits can pay for the cost of treatment at some of the world's leading mesothelioma clinics and also provide a monthly disability benefit that is based upon the severity of a service-related illness or injury like mesothelioma.
